MPO agrees on Beach bridge painting

1 min read

The Lee County Metropolitan Planning Organization voted unanimously to support the painting of Matanzas Pass Bridge on Fort Myers Beach sometime this spring or summer according to a news report which was announced at the annual Chamber Gala at Pink Shell Resort.

FMB Councilman Bob Raymond, the recently elected 2010 vice chairman of Lee MPO, made the motion for the action Friday and was seconded by Lee County Commissioner and MPO Chairman Ray Judah. The bridge is expected to be painted a lighter shade of blue by the Florida Department of Transportation.
